End of lease for my ML350
My lease is ending in a couple of months. The car (06') just went over 50k miles and it need the Service D done. Can i return the car without doing the service or will they require me to do the service before returning??? Thanks in advance.

That's a good question. Call your leasing company and ask them. Now, chances are they are going to tell you that you have to do the service.
Before you do, wait to get the "end of lease" package. It will tell you what is and is not acceptable.
There is of course the third option (and I know I will catch a lot of heat for saying this)... which is to just reset the service light.

If the lease is with MB Financial I believe they require all services to be complied. If its not done they will charge you for it. Best to have it done when you have some control over the costs.

I recently turned in a 07 E350 to MB Financial. I did all the maintenance myself and was never asked to provide any proof of completion. So if I'd just reset the indicator, no one would have ever known.
